ERNiCr-4 Welding Wire (Inconel 600 / UNS N06600)
Nickel-chromium alloy filler metal for corrosion and oxidation resistance in high-temperature applications.

Product Overview
ERNiCr-4 is a solid nickel-chromium alloy welding wire specifically designed for welding base metals of similar composition such as Inconel® 600 (UNS N06600). Known for its excellent resistance to oxidation, corrosion, and carburization, this filler metal is ideal for use in high-temperature and chemically aggressive environments.
It is suitable for both TIG (GTAW) and MIG (GMAW) welding processes, offering stable arc characteristics, smooth bead formation, and good mechanical performance. ERNiCr-4 is widely used in the chemical processing, nuclear, aerospace, and marine industries.
Key Features
- Excellent resistance to oxidation and corrosion in high-temperature environments
- Outstanding resistance to carburization and chloride-ion stress corrosion cracking
- Good mechanical strength and metallurgical stability up to 1093°C (2000°F)
- Suitable for welding Inconel 600 and related nickel-chromium alloys
- Easy to weld with stable arc and low spatter in TIG/MIG processes
- Used for overlaying, joining, and repair applications
- Meets AWS A5.14 ERNiCr-4 and equivalent standards
Common Names / Designations
- AWS: ERNiCr-4
- UNS: N06600
- Trade Name: Inconel 600 Welding Wire
- Other Names: Nickel 600 filler wire, Alloy 600 TIG/MIG rod, NiCr 600 weld wire
Typical Applications
- Furnace and heat treating components
- Food processing and chemical vessels
- Steam generator tubing
- Heat exchanger shells and tube sheets
- Nuclear reactor hardware
- Dissimilar metal joining of Ni-based and Fe-based alloys
Chemical Composition (% Typical)
Element | Content (%) |
---|---|
Nickel (Ni) | ≥ 70.0 |
Chromium (Cr) | 14.0 - 17.0 |
Iron (Fe) | 6.0 - 10.0 |
Manganese (Mn) | ≤ 1.0 |
Carbon (C) | ≤ 0.10 |
Silicon (Si) | ≤ 0.50 |
Sulfur (S) | ≤ 0.015 |
Others | Traces |
Mechanical Properties (Typical)
Property | Value |
---|---|
Tensile Strength | ≥ 550 MPa |
Yield Strength | ≥ 250 MPa |
Elongation | ≥ 30% |
Operating Temp. | Up to 1093°C |
Oxidation Resistance | Excellent |
